The Decree of the President of the Republic of Uzbekistan of 16 June 2021 No. PD-6247 provides for the Jokargy Kenes of the Republic of Karakalpakstan, regional, district, city Kengashes (Councils) of people’s representatives to conduct live broadcasts from sessions on TV channels as well as their live streaming.
Based on this, the Anti-Corruption Agency of the Republic of Uzbekistan performed a monitoring of live-streamed sessions of the Jokargy Kenes of the Republic of Karakalpakstan, regional, Tashkent city, district and city Kengashes of people’s representatives from December 1, 2021 to January 10, 2022.
The monitoring results showed that the most unsatisfactory indicator in Bukhara Region. In particular, 81 percent of the total number of sessions of regional, district and city Kengashes of people’s representatives were not broadcast live.
The best indicators were recorded in Andijan Region, where only 36 percent of the total number of sessions of regional, district and city Councils of people’s representatives were not broadcast live.
When analyzing the results in the context of the regional Councils, the Navoi Regional Council of people’s representatives was the only regional Council that fully live-streamed all sessions during the monitoring period. As for the district Councils, all sessions of the Bekobod and Bostonliq District Councils of people’s representatives of Tashkent Region were broadcast live in full.
During the monitoring, cases of incomplete (several minutes) live streaming of a number of sessions of the Councils of people’s representatives on the Internet were also recorded.
Due to the shortcomings identified, the regional Councils were instructed to conduct all future sessions live, in accordance with the requirements of the Decree.
